Lee
County in South Carolina
County
The population development of Lee.
Name | Status | Population Census 1990-04-01 | Population Census 2000-04-01 | Population Census 2010-04-01 | Population Census 2020-04-01 | |
---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
Lee | County | 18,437 | 20,119 | 19,220 | 16,531 | → |
South Carolina | State | 3,486,703 | 4,012,012 | 4,625,364 | 5,118,425 |

The population development of the places in Lee.
Name | Status | County | Population Census 1990-04-01 | Population Census 2000-04-01 | Population Census 2010-04-01 | Population Census 2020-04-01 | |
---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
Ashwood | Census-Designated Place | Lee | 108 | 229 | 139 | 116 | → |
Bishopville | City | Lee | 3,687 | 3,682 | 3,464 | 3,015 | → |
Browntown | Census-Designated Place | Lee | 279 | 291 | 303 | 206 | → |
Elliott | Census-Designated Place | Lee | 411 | 434 | 381 | 370 | → |
Lynchburg | Town | Lee | 475 | 589 | 358 | 318 | → |
Manville | Census-Designated Place | Lee | 287 | 463 | 420 | 471 | → |
St. Charles | Census-Designated Place | Lee | 220 | 187 | 127 | 114 | → |
Wisacky | Census-Designated Place | Lee | 257 | 308 | 203 | 185 | → |
Source: U.S. Census Bureau (web).
Explanation: Latest available rebased population figures are used. In case of significant changes, they were recalculated by using census block data.
